4TH CENTRAL ORIENTATION PROGRAMME (2025/2026 SESSION)
The College Overseer of the Federal College of Education (FCE), Jama'are, Dr. Abraham Yusuf Gana, cordially invites the general public, staff, and especially newly admitted students to the 4th Central Orientation Programme for the 2025/2026 Academic Session.
This programme is a vital milestone for new students, designed to integrate them into the academic, social, and ethical fabric of the College.
I. EVENT DETAILS
- Date: Thursday, 28th April 2026.
- Time: 10:00 AM prompt.
- Venue: Theatre Hall, FCE Jama'are.
II. OBJECTIVES OF THE ORIENTATION
The Central Orientation serves as a formal introduction to the College’s operational standards. Key areas to be covered include:
- Academic Regulations: Understanding the grading system, course registration procedures, and examination ethics.
- Institutional Policies: Familiarization with the College’s code of conduct and core values.
- Student Support Services: Introduction to the Library, Medical Centre, and Student Affairs directorate.
- Campus Security: Essential safety tips and emergency contact protocols within the Jama'are community.
III. ATTENDANCE DIRECTIVE
Attendance is mandatory for all newly admitted students (100 Level and Direct Entry). This session provides the foundational information required to navigate the 2025/2026 session successfully and avoid common administrative pitfalls.
Staff members and student leaders are also encouraged to attend to support the transition of the new intake.
